Surviving the holidays

Its that time of year! Next week begins the festivities of the season and with that comes, potatoes, stuffing, gravy, pies, cookies, breads...AHHHHH! Sweet symphonies of delicious comfort food! But wait! What does that mean for the waistline?

Over the past year, I've learned to regulate myself and watch my portions and also watch what I eat and when. Even with clean eating, we allow ourselves one cheat a week and I'll be sure and savour that Thanksgiving meal, and not feel like I'm punishing myself at all the other holiday functions and parties. The important thing is that I put myself back in check and not allow those occasional meals to reset the pattern. I'll need to make sure that the following days, my carbs are lower and that I don't allow myself to store the extra sugar and fats.

Things I remind myself of to help me get through the season are:

1. Exercise! Don't let it slip!
2. Watch portions.
3. If you crave it, eat it. Just don't binge. I take "nibbles" to satisfy the craving and then remind myself that its not worth it...
4. Reset by having two days of low carbs following a large cheat meal.
5. I am not resisting food to punish myself. I resist it because I choose to be healthy and strong. I deserve to be fit and healthy. Its the BEST thing I can do for myself.

Celebrate the season, but don't finish off the year wishing for a new body...start the new year fit and healthy with the best gift you can give yourself!
